The Science Behind Attention Retention in Digital Learning

Neuroscience research demonstrates that the human brain processes information most effectively in short, focused bursts. According to cognitive science principles, deliberate interruptions can actually enhance learning when properly structured. The interactive pause extension leverages this by:

  • Automatically pausing videos at strategic intervals
  • Presenting comprehension-check questions
  • Providing immediate feedback
  • Allowing brief mental processing time

Implementation in K12 Classrooms

Teachers using this digital focus tool report significant improvements in student engagement. The extension’s customizable features include:

  • Adjustable pause frequency based on grade level
  • Multiple question formats (multiple choice, short answer)
  • Progress tracking for educators
  • Gamification elements to maintain motivation

Initial pilot programs showed a 42% increase in content retention compared to traditional video lessons. Furthermore, students using the tool demonstrated 28% better performance on subsequent assessments.
